Tour the new 2024 Airstream Basecamp 20X—sleek and smart

In the video below, we join Gabby of RVs with Gabby for a tour of the 2024 Airstream Basecamp 20X.

This is a sleek, quality trailer with everything you need for off-grid adventures, which is what the X in the name signifies. This means more ground and tank clearance and other features to enhance the off-road and off-grid experience.

I love the propane tank cover with a built-in storage compartment above the tanks. I am not sure why more manufacturers don’t do this!

The top of the rig is outfitted with a rail so that you can attach a variety of Keder Rail Accessories to increase the Basecamp’s functionality.

Inside is larger than you might think. The front has a U-shaped dinette that, of course, converts to a bed. The back also features a large convertible seating and sleeping area with a small table. Need two twin beds? No problem. One larger bed? You can do that too!

In between the two beds is a small but functional wet bath and a small kitchen with fridge, microwave, and 2-burner stove. For additional food storage, the back under-floor storage is outfitted with a drain so it can be used as a cooler. Smart!Airstream basecamp interior

More nice features of the 2024 Airstream Basecamp 20X

  • 19,000 BTU ducted furnace
  • 3000 watts solar with lithium batteries optional
  • Goodyear Wrangler tires
  • Stainless steel front rock guard
  • Solar covers on front windows

What’s not to like?

It’s an Airstream, so expect a hefty price tag. On the plus side, Airstreams also tend to hold their value well.

2024 Airstream Basecamp 20X Spaces

  • Length: 20’2”
  • GVWR: 4300 pounds
  • Cargo carrying capacity: 900 pounds
  • Fresh water: 23 gallons
  • Gray water: 28 gallons
  • Black water: 21 gallons
  • 30-amp service
  • Sleeps: Up to 4
